"You are given a string seq made up only of the characters 'A' and 'B'. You may repeatedly perform the following operation: - Delete any occurrence of the substring 'AB' or 'BB'. - After deletion, the remaining parts of the string are concatenated. Your task is to determine the minimum possible length of the string after performing any number of valid deletions. Note: A substring refers to a contiguous sequence of characters. Return the minimum remaining length."
